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
093299 7844 3370308 4046
346 742523785
346 742523785
6039391532 34273 4568 063
All about undefined
Interested in learning more?
346 742523785
6039391532 34273 4568 063
See more
365608 12476160
4871 78101 6844 230913
See more
70517540071 6984130
27140954 5503629841 00
See more